Burberry Color Chart: A Spectrum of Sophistication

Understanding Burberry's colour palette requires moving beyond a simple “signature colour.” While a specific shade of beige or camel often springs to mind, the reality is far more nuanced. A comprehensive Burberry colour chart would encompass a spectrum of tones, subtly varying in intensity and saturation, yet all maintaining a cohesive and recognizable family resemblance. This family can be broadly categorized into neutrals, which form the foundation of the brand's identity, and accent colours, which add pops of vibrancy and modernity.

The core of the Burberry colour chart is built around various shades of beige, camel, and ivory. These classic neutrals evoke a sense of timelessness and sophistication, reflecting the brand's heritage and its association with traditional British style. Different shades of these neutrals are used strategically across different products and collections, creating subtle variations that cater to diverse tastes and seasonal trends. For example, a lighter, almost cream-coloured beige might be used for spring/summer collections, while a richer, deeper camel might be preferred for autumn/winter.

Beyond the core neutrals, the Burberry colour chart includes a range of other colours, often used as accents to complement the foundational shades. These include various shades of brown, ranging from dark chocolate to light hazelnut, as well as subtle shades of grey, navy, and even olive green. These colours add depth and complexity to the overall palette, preventing it from becoming monotonous. Occasionally, bolder colours such as red, burgundy, and even vibrant blues are incorporated, particularly in limited-edition collections or collaborations like the COLORS x Burberry HOMEGROWN project, adding a contemporary twist to the brand's heritage.

Burberry Color Scheme: Balance and Harmony

The Burberry colour scheme is characterized by its inherent balance and harmony. The brand masterfully employs a principle of contrast and complementarity, skillfully juxtaposing the calm neutrality of its core colours with the occasional boldness of accent shades. This allows for the creation of both understated elegance and striking visual impact, depending on the specific design and context.

A common Burberry colour scheme involves pairing a neutral base, such as camel or beige, with a darker accent colour like navy or brown. This creates a visually pleasing contrast, enhancing the overall appeal of the garment or accessory. Alternatively, the brand might use a monochromatic scheme, employing various shades of the same colour, such as different tones of beige or brown, to create a sense of refined unity.

The strategic use of colour blocking is another hallmark of Burberry's colour scheme. This technique involves using blocks of different colours, often from within the brand's established palette, to create visually interesting designs. The careful selection of colours and their placement ensure that the final product remains cohesive and aesthetically pleasing, reflecting the brand's commitment to both tradition and innovation.
